Professionalism, dentistry and public health
Social Science & Medicine. Part A: Medical Psychology & Medical Sociology, 1980Abstract The control of rival producers of health care is an integral feature of both medical and dental professionalization. This paper examines the stratagems employed by the dental profession in Britain to shape the dental division of labour. The elimination and controlled re-introduction of dental auxiliaries are discussed, together with an ...

Elder Mistreatment: Implications for Public Health Dentistry
Journal of Public Health Dentistry, 2001AbstractElder mistreatment has increasingly been recognized as a serious and complex health issue affecting large numbers of elders each year. Health professionals have been found to lack knowledge regarding assessment, diagnosis, intervention, and reporting criteria of this problem.
